David Johns serves as both in-house Intellectual Property Law Counsel to W. L. Gore & Associates, Inc., where his commitments include leading its global trademark team, and of counsel to the Northern Arizona law firm of Aspey, Watkins & Diesel, PLLC, where his focus is on supporting the business and intellectual property law needs of start-up and growing businesses.
During David’s 30+ year tenure at Gore, he has helped launch, grow, and protect numerous new product lines, including Gore’s many life-saving implantable medical devices, GORE-TEX®, SITKA®, and GOREWEAR Clothing Products, GLIDE® Floss and ELIXIR® Guitar String businesses, and numerous other highly successful product lines.
Gore encourages its associates to take an active role in supporting Arizona communities. To this end, David has volunteered his time extensively to help entrepreneurs find ways to protect their new business concepts and launch and grow new business ventures. David was an early supporter of the business incubator program in Flagstaff and coached a number of the early businesses coming out of the first incubator program, including Kahtoola, Inc.
David has served for many years on the Board of Directors of Moonshot, twice acting as the Secretary of the Board. David has also developed and provided training programs on ways that business concepts can be legal protected, served as an advisor and mentor for new business ventures, and participated as a volunteer coach and judge for Moonshot Pitch Events throughout Arizona.
David’s passion for supporting entrepreneurial businesses led him to join Aspey, Watkins & Diesel full time in 2023.
